Method for extracting sorghum red pigment
A technology of sorghum red pigment and an extraction method, which is applied in the field of extraction of natural pigments, can solve problems such as harm to human body, complicated extraction process, easily induced poisoning, etc., and achieves the effects of strong tinting strength, simple extraction process and natural color and luster.

Examples
Embodiment 1
[0014] Wash 1000 grams of sorghum husks with water, dry and pulverize them, add them to a reactor with a stirrer, add 2000 milliliters of ethanol with a concentration of 60% under constant stirring, and then add hydrochloric acid with a concentration of 5% to adjust the pH of the reaction solution When the value is 1, heat up to 80°C and keep warm for 2 hours to extract; after the reaction, let it stand for 20 minutes, filter off the residue, adjust the filtrate to neutrality with 15% sodium hydroxide solution, and add the filtrate to the still In the process, the red crude product was obtained after recovering ethanol by distillation under reduced pressure; adding ethyl acetate of twice the amount of the crude product, stirring for half an hour, so that the salt in the crude product was dissolved in ethyl acetate, performing vacuum distillation, and recovering the ethyl acetate. Get brownish red sorghum red pigment finished product:
Embodiment 2
[0016] Wash 1500 grams of sorghum husks with water, dry and crush them, add them to a reactor with a stirrer, add 3000 milliliters of ethanol with a concentration of 60% under constant stirring, and then add hydrochloric acid with a concentration of 8% to adjust the pH of the reaction solution The value is 1, heat up to 85°C, and extract after 2.5 hours of heat preservation; after the reaction, let it stand for 25 minutes, filter off the residue, adjust the filtrate to neutrality with 12% sodium hydroxide solution, and add the filtrate to the still In the process, the red crude product was obtained after recovering ethanol by distillation under reduced pressure; adding ethyl acetate of twice the amount of the crude product, stirring for half an hour, so that the salt in the crude product was dissolved in ethyl acetate, performing vacuum distillation, and recovering the ethyl acetate. The finished brown-red sorghum red pigment is obtained;
Embodiment 3
[0018] Wash 2000 grams of sorghum husks with water, dry and pulverize them, add them to a reactor with a stirrer, add 4000 milliliters of ethanol with a concentration of 60% under constant stirring, and then add hydrochloric acid with a concentration of 10% to adjust the pH of the reaction solution When the value is 1, heat up to 90°C and keep warm for 3 hours to extract; after the reaction, let it stand for 30 minutes, filter off the residue, adjust the filtrate to neutrality with 15% sodium hydroxide solution, and add the filtrate to the still In the process, the red crude product was obtained after recovering ethanol by distillation under reduced pressure; adding ethyl acetate of twice the amount of the crude product, stirring for half an hour, so that the salt in the crude product was dissolved in ethyl acetate, performing vacuum distillation, and recovering the ethyl acetate. The finished brown-red sorghum red pigment is obtained.
